Gengar Miniatura Horrifies Pokemon Enthusiasts
A Pokemon enthusiast recently unveiled a chilling Gengar miniature, showcasing exceptional painting skills. While many Pokemon fans adore the franchise's cute characters, this miniature perfectly captures the appeal of its scarier creatures.
Gengar, a Ghost/Poison-type Pokemon from the first generation, is the evolved form of Gastly and Haunter. Its iconic design has made it a fan favorite, and its Mega Evolution (introduced in Gen 6) further cemented its popularity.
A fan, HoldMyGranade, shared their terrifying Gengar miniature, featuring menacing red eyes, sharp teeth, and a long, protruding tongue – a far cry from the game's original depiction. HoldMyGranade meticulously painted the miniature, resulting in a striking and detailed piece that garnered over 1,100 upvotes on r/pokemon.
A Showcase of Pokemon Fan Creativity
The Pokemon community is renowned for its artistic talent, extending beyond drawings. For example, a previous project showcased a stunning 3D-printed and painted Hisuian Growlithe miniature, realistically blending the Pokemon with a real dog.
Other fans express their creativity through crocheting. A recent example is a crocheted Eternatus doll, surprisingly cute despite the original Pokemon's monstrous appearance.
The artistry extends to other mediums as well; a few months ago, a fan carved a detailed wooden Tauros figurine, demonstrating exceptional skill in woodworking.
